RiverCenter Accessibility Guidelines

We want the RiverCenter experience to be accessible to all patrons. We’re here to help make your RiverCenter visit a pleasant experience and fulfill your accessibility needs. To ensure equal and fair access to the facility and services, the RiverCenter shall comply with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) and all other applicable federal, state, and local regulation. We will make reasonable accommodations when necessary to ensure accessible services to individuals with disabilities.  The RiverCenter does NOT provide wheelchairs or other mobility devices.

Elevators in each RiverCenter buildings

ADA compliant bathroom stalls

Animals

Service Animals as defined by the American Disabilities Act (ADA) are permitted.

Drop Off & Parking

In front of the RiverCenter entrances on 3rd Street (please put on hazard lights when dropping off).

There are wheelchair ramp accessible drop off area at both buildings.

There is also a City managed parking garage directly across from the facility that is connected via a skywalk, all handicap accessible. 2-hour street parking is available during the week (Monday-Friday) prior to 5PM and FREE on the weekends.   Handi-cap parking spaces are available on streets surrounding the RiverCenter and in ramp on a first-come-first-serve basis.
